Two objects of masses m1 = 0.42 kg and m2 = 0.96 kg are placed on a horizontal frictionless surface and a compressed spring of force constant k = 270 N/m is placed between them as in figure (a) shown below. Neglect the mass of the spring. The spring is not attached to either object and is compressed a distance of 9.6 cm. If the objects are released from rest, find the final velocity of each object as shown in figure (b). (Let the positive direction be to the right. Indicate the direction with the sign of your answer.)Explanation / Answer
conswerving momentum,
v1/v2 = m2/m1 = 0.96/0.42 = 2.286
So, 0.5*0.42*v^2*2.286^2 + 0.5*0.96*v^2 = 0.5*270*0.096^2
So, v1 = 2.03 m/s <------velocity of m1
v2 = 0.888 m/s <-----velocity of m2
